Crime overview

Garth Road area has the 22nd lowest crime rate of 54 local areas in Trowbridge Adcroft , and the 659th highest crime rate of 1,622 local areas in Wiltshire .

At least one of the neighbouring streets has high or very high crime levels. However, overall crime around this postcode is more mixed, with some nearby areas experiencing lower crime.

The overall crime rate in the area around Garth Road (BA14 7GP) in the last 12 months was 49.3 per 1,000 residents and was 61.2% lower than the Trowbridge Adcroft average (127.0 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 7 offences recorded. The least common crime was Vehicle crime with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Violence and sexual offences ( 75.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Anti-social behaviour ( -40.0%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 7 (≈ 31.4 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 75.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-77.9%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Garth Road (BA14 7GP), the main crime hotspot is near Malwayn Close. Police recorded 21 crimes here, including 17 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
